New York University's School of Continuing and Professional Studies is pleased to present the 67th Institute on Federal Taxation. For hundreds of tax practitioners, the NYU Institute on Federal Taxation is the event of the year. The Institute addresses all major areas of taxation and attracts attorneys, both general tax practitioners and specialists; accountants; corporate treasury and compliance executives; tax managers; and financial planners seeking expert discussion of the latest technical, legislative, and planning developments.
The Institute is designed for the practitioner who must frequently anticipate and handle federal tax matters. It provides high-level updates, practical advice you can implement, and in-depth analysis of the latest trends and developments from leading experts. Attendees return to work with a wealth of materials, plus the tools and strategies needed to help save their clients' tax dollars and provide them with better service. Just as important, the Institute provides the perfect setting to meet practitioners from all around the country. It’s an opportunity to share ideas, exchange views, learn what others are doing, and obtain credit for continuing education.
